Understanding Roofing Squares

A roofing square is a measurement unit used in roofing, equivalent to a 10-foot by 10-foot area or 100 square feet. This standard measurement helps determine the amount of materials needed for a roofing project, including shingles, underlayment, and nails. Knowing how many roof nails per square is crucial for ensuring a secure and durable installation.

Installation Tips for Optimal Performance

Proper installation of roofing nails is crucial for ensuring durability and performance. Consider the following tips:

  • Placement: Nails should be driven straight and flush with the surface of the roofing material to avoid leaks.
  • Spacing: Follow manufacturer guidelines for spacing, as improper spacing can lead to structural issues.
  • Quality: Use corrosion-resistant nails, especially in coastal areas where salt can degrade metal over time.
  • Inspection: Regularly check the roof after installation to ensure no nails have popped or become loose, especially after severe weather.

These guidelines will help ensure that the roofing installation is effective and long-lasting.
